๐Ÿงฉ Psychological Concept: Groupthink & Enmeshment


Groupthink happens when a desire for harmony and belonging leads individuals to suppress dissenting opinions or moral concerns for the sake of unity.


In law enforcement, this often pairs with emotional enmeshment, where personal identity and group identity become inseparable. While the "family" mindset can foster deep trust, it can also discourage individuality, silence ethical concerns, and make it difficult to set healthy boundaries.


Understanding this balance is key to protecting both your integrity and your mental health.


๐Ÿ‘ฎโ€โ™‚๏ธ 5 Signs the "Family" Culture Has Become Controlling


Loyalty Is Measured by Silence
Speaking up about unethical behavior is seen as betrayal instead of courage.


Personal Identity Fades Into the Job
You stop introducing yourself as you โ€” everything revolves around the uniform.


Favoritism Is Mistaken for Brotherhood
Belonging becomes conditional on compliance, not connection.


You Fear Rejection More Than Burnout
You stay quiet, overwork, or take on more just to be accepted.


You Can't Trust Outsiders
Friends, family, or therapists outside "the family" are viewed with suspicion.


๐Ÿ’ก 5 Ways to Stay Connected Without Losing Yourself


Define What Brotherhood Really Means
True loyalty includes accountability, honesty, and mutual respect โ€” not blind obedience.


Maintain a Circle Outside the Job
Real balance comes from having relationships that don't depend on rank or shift.


Speak Up โ€” Respectfully and Early
Healthy teams can disagree without fear. Silence only strengthens dysfunction.


Know Your Emotional Boundaries
You can care deeply about your team without absorbing their trauma or politics.


Revisit Your Core Identity Regularly
Ask: "Who am I if I'm not in uniform?" โ€” and make sure you're nurturing that person.
